Michigan Compiled Laws § 445.773 Unlawful Monopoly.


445.773 Unlawful monopoly.

Sec. 3.

The establishment, maintenance, or use of a monopoly, or any attempt to establish a monopoly, of trade or commerce in a relevant market by any person, for the purpose of excluding or limiting competition or controlling, fixing, or maintaining prices, is unlawful.


History: 1984, Act 274, Eff. Mar. 29, 1985
